Responsibilities
- Welcome patients in the dental office
- Prepare patients for treatments or checkups ensuring their comfort
- Select and set up instruments, equipment and material needed
- Sterilize instruments according to regulations
- Routine equipment maintenance
- Assist the dentist through 4-handed dentistry
- Take clear and accurate x-rays and scans
- Undertake lab tasks as instructed
- Provide post-operative care instructions
- Keep the dental rooms clean and well-stocked
- Maintain accurate patient records
Skills
- Knowledge of dental instruments and sterilization methods
- X-ray certification
- Understanding of health & safety regulations
- Computer skills, patient charting
- Excellent communication and people skills
- Attention to detail
- Well-organized, hard working and reliable
- High school diploma; graduating from dental assistant school is preferred
